Estrogen and progesterone receptors positive

WebNearly 70% of breast carcinomas express steroid hormone receptors and therefore patients can be treated with endocrine therapy. The treatment is principally targeted to block the estrogen receptor (ER) or estrogen synthesis (1). However, increasing evidence also suggests that the progesterone receptor (PR) is a potential target for therapy (2).
